The Henhouse is a two story unit, with a very large bedroom upstairs, en-suite with a balcony looking around the surrounding countryside and forest. Downstairs there is a twin room, also en-suite. There is a large living room/dining room area and a separate fully-fitted kitchen. It includes linen and towels, satellite and internet TV, WiFi and parking for two private cars. Gas and electricity are a metered extra, but this is usually a token extra.

This is the perfect place to start your Ireland adventure. We are less than forty minutes from the Dublin city centre. The Henhouse is only a fifteen minute drive from Dublin Airport, but is deep in the countryside. It is also two miles from Ratoath or Ashbourne, where you can enjoy all modern amenities. Local supermarkets and food delivery services deliver to us and there is a regular taxi service. The 109a bus from the airport stops around 1km from us and the 103 bus to Dublin city centre goes by every 20 minutes. We are less than half an hour from the UNESCO Heritage site Newgrange, from the Hill of Tara. We are ten minutes from Tayto Park, the renowned theme park.
